Ardeshir, > The same thing, by the way, applies to cars with huge fans sucking up > air from underneath and thereby producing gobs of down-force even on > the slowest curves. They were banned because cars equipped with such > fans would easily out-distance the present cars. Er, no. They (the Chaparral 2J) were banned for a very good safety reason. They sucked up debris from the track and spit it out the rear of the car. It was a severe safety hazard. A small pebble or even marbles (and if you have a clue about auto racing, you'd know what marbles were...but now that you've found out how to search for things on the Internet and become an instant expert, I'm sure you can find it that way as well) could potentially kill or seriously injure a driver (or someone on the trackside) if "spit" from one of these cars.
